I recently came across a Tamron CONVERTO lens, 128/2.8, with an SR/MD converter mounted.

It has ~12 aperture blades, and pre-set aperture rings.
Mine has a chunk of the filter thread broken off.

Note to anyone interested in one that the Converto 'T-mount' may not be the modern one. It may be a T2 37mmx0.75mm; see Tamron Converto 135mm | The Camera Collector
